Graveside services for Linda McDougald, 85, of Lufkin, will be held Saturday, March 16, 2019 at 11:00 a.m. in the Garden of Memories Memorial Park with Brother Darryl Bennett officiating.
Mrs. McDougald was born September 12, 1933 in Huntington, Texas to the late Ruth (Smithheart) and Henry Cook, and died Wednesday, March 13, 2019 in a local hospice facility.
Mrs. McDougald had resided in Lufkin for 18 years and was a homemaker. She was an avid antique collector and dealer. She loved flowers, especially orchids. Linda was a loving wife, mother, sister, aunt and friend who will be greatly missed by all who were blessed to know her. Mrs. McDougald was a member of First Christian Church.
Survivors include her husband of 61 years, James McDougald of Lufkin; granddaughter, Jessie Weaver of Lufkin; grandson, Jimmie Weaver of Texas; sister, Janice Wheeler and husband Carlton of Deer Park; and numerous other relatives and friends.
She was preceded in death by her parents; son, Charles Weaver; granddaughter, Elizabeth Weaver; and niece, Denise Beard.
